i meant that writing data to the console (from tex) can be responsible
for additional runtime; it depends (sometimes) on the font used on the
console (osx), ansi control sequence interception, and buffering (the
standard wondows console doesn't buffer, conemu on windows does, on
other operating systems it depends) .. tex writes in chunks (no line
buffering) because it's often progress info (although context does bit
of optimization)
